Welder Salary in Chico, CA: $50,685 (2026)

Quick Answer:A full-time welder in Chico, CA earns a median $50,685/year (≈ $24.38/hour) in nominal terms for 2026 — proj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 51-4121). Once you factor in Chico's price level (1% above national, BEA RPP 101.2), that paycheck buys what $50,085 would nationally. Nominal pay sits 8.5% below the California state average.

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for the Chico metropolitan area, the median welder salary grew 30.0% from $37,490 (2019) to $48,740 (2025). At a 3.99% compound annual growth rate, salaries are projected to reach $52,707 by 2027 — a total increase of $15,217 (40.59%) from 2019.

Note: Historical values (20192025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the Chico met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 20262026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 3.99% CAGR derived from 7-year BLS historical data. Welder Job Market in Chico

In Chico, there are approximately 160 welders employed, reflecting a solid presence for this trade in the local job market. The cost-of-living index, which sits at 101.197, slightly above the national average, will influence take-home pay and affordability in the area. Employers such as structural steel fabrication shops and petrochemical turnaround crews tend to offer the most lucrative positions, with pay varying significantly based on factors like certifications, specialty work, and the nature of employment (traveling vs. local). For instance, welders possessing the 6G pipe certification or those involved in underwater and nuclear work can command premium wages, while companies may offer additional per diem for traveling jobs, enhancing overall compensation.
